Output e57060eebafbca2cb904eb0daba1a8633f2c152bc80ab5f59a175ca43e77106a:3

value
766523997
script pubkey
OP_0 OP_PUSHBYTES_20 c18343677c8dfaee1965095922f357c98892c7b3
address
ltc1qcxp5xemu3hawuxt9p9vj9u6hexyf93annapqt8
transaction
e57060eebafbca2cb904eb0daba1a8633f2c152bc80ab5f59a175ca43e77106a
spent
true